Created by Guido van Rossum and released in 1991, Python is one of the most popular programming languages today. As an open-source language, Python is free to use and distribute—even for commercial purposes! It’s versatile, too—you can build nearly anything with it, from web applications to data science projects, machine learning models, and more. Python’s simple, English-like syntax makes it easier to learn and write than other languages like C++ or Java, making it a top choice for developers worldwide.
